What is the Council Tax Property Exemption Form?

The Council Tax Property Exemption Form serves as a crucial document in the UK for individuals seeking to apply for an exemption from council tax for unoccupied properties. This form is primarily intended for cases where a mortgagee, or loan provider, has taken possession of the property. It ensures that property owners can declare their eligibility for the exemption status associated with unoccupied properties.
Completing this form is essential as it establishes the timeline for the exemption, which begins from the date the property becomes unoccupied until it is either sold or possession is returned to the owner.

Eligibility Criteria for the Council Tax Property Exemption Form

To qualify for the council tax exemption, certain eligibility criteria must be met by both the property owner and the mortgagee. These include:
  • The property must be unoccupied and unfurnished.
  • The mortgagee must have taken possession of the property.
  • Specific conditions regarding possession must be satisfied.
Understanding these requirements is essential for anyone looking to utilize the council tax exemption form effectively.
